True North: Discovering God's Way in a Changing World

"Our modern world resembles a vast, uncharted ocean," says Gary Inrig. "We are no longer in familiar territory. Huge changes are sweeping across our world, and these changes have made our maps obsolete. We have never been here before. A fundamental fact of life in the third millennium is that nothing is as permanent as change."

Do you feel bewildered in the midst of a rapidly changing, unpredictable world? Let Gary Inrig show you the way to find peace, confidence, and stability.

A major shift has taken place in Western culture, radically redefining concepts of truth, morality, and spirituality. Public opinion is no longer shaped by Judeo-Christian values. Diversity rules, tolerance is supreme, and relativism is the only absolute. We need tools and skills that can help us navigate this precarious world of the twenty-first century. Inrig gives practical and inspirational insights into how, with Jesus Christ as your compass, you can learn to chart a successful life course: to understand why you live, for whom you live, where you are going, and  how to get there safely.

About the Author

Gary Inrig is a graduate of the University of British Columbia and Dallas Theological Seminary. Dr. Inrig is pastor of Trinity Evangelical Free Church in Redlands, California, and has written several books, including True North, Whole Marriages in a Broken World, Forgiveness, and Pure Desire.
